About the Scholarship

That’s why we have established the dsm-firmenich Progress Foundation, to make a positive difference in the world. The independent dsm-firmenich Progress Foundation is focused on driving sustainable change, empowering communities and supporting the next generation of changemakers. 

The Foundation is proud to offer five impactful young leaders the opportunity to participate in the One Young World Summit 2025, which takes place in Munich, Germany, from 3 - 6 November.

Through the dsm-firmenich Progress Foundation Scholarship2025 the Foundation will support young entrepreneurs making a local or global impact in communities around the globe in one of three focus areas:

  • Fighting malnutrition.
  • Strengthening community resilience. 
  • Protecting and restoring ecosystems. 

Examples of relevant work include, but are not limited to:

  • Initiatives which address micronutrient deficiencies and ensure food with the highest quality and nutritional value reach the most vulnerable. 
  • Initiatives which strengthen community resilience and address social inequality.
  • Initiatives that restore and protect ecosystems, building nature’s resilience by addressing climate action, biodiversity protection, and safeguarding water systems. 

What is One Young World?

One Young World was founded in 2009 by David Jones and Kate Robertson. We are a UK-based charity that gathers together the brightest young leaders from around the world, empowering them to make lasting connections to create positive change. 

We stage an annual Summit where the most valuable young talent from global and national companies, NGOs, universities and other forward-thinking organisations are joined by world leaders, acting as the One Young World Counsellors.

Delegates participate in four transformative days of speeches, panels, networking and workshops. All delegates have the opportunity to apply to give keynote speeches, sharing a platform with world leaders with the world’s media in attendance. As well as listening to keynote speakers, delegates have the opportunity to challenge world leaders, interact and be mentored by influencers. Delegates make lasting connections throughout the Summit, celebrating their participation at social events and the unforgettable Opening and Closing Ceremonies.

After each Summit, the delegates, who are then known as One Young World Ambassadors, work on their own initiatives or lend the power of the One Young World network to those initiatives already in existence. Of those in employment, many returns to their companies and set about creating change from within, energising their corporate environment.

Scholarship Eligibility Criteria

  • Aged 18 - 30* at the time of the One Young World Summit 2025
  • Reside in Africa, Asia-Pacific or Latin America. 
  • Have 3 - 5 years’ experience in business,  preferably running their own enterprise. 
  • Are making a positive impact in one of the three scholarship focus areas:
    • Fighting malnutrition
    • Strengthening community resilience
    • Protecting and restoring ecosystems
  • One Young World will make efforts to shortlist candidates who have had limited opportunities for national/international exposure.

* Most delegates are between the ages of 18 and 30. The One Young World team will consider candidates who are older than 30, pending demonstration of appropriate personal impact, initiative, and willingness to engage. We are not able to accept applications from those who will be aged under 18 at the time of the Summit.

Cost/funding for participants

Scholars will receive:

  • Access to the One Young World Summit 2025 in Munich, Germany. 
  • Hotel accommodation in Munich, checking in on 31 October and checking out on 8 November. 
  • Travel to and from Munich (in economy). 
  • All meals covered (includes breakfast, lunch and dinner on conference days).
  • Ground transport between the Summit accommodation and the Summit venue.
  • Pre-programme in Munich and the opportunity to join the dsm-firmenich delegation during the summit.
